Jamming with Jack Mitrani at Mt. Baker

By: Heather Hendricks

Frends Crew funny man Jack Mitrani isn't afraid of a good time. He's normally the guy behind lens creating the hysterical videos that show up on FrendsVision.com. He always joking around and seems to have a trick up his sleeve at any given moment.

Recently, during a trip to Mt. Baker with Anon Optics, Jack hopped on the other side of the camera and busted out a few classic jams to pass the time and wait for pow.

In the first video, Jack taps into his inner Enrique Iglesias and belts out an acoustic version of "I Can Be Your Hero." The song is used as the soundtrack to the antics Jack gets into during his Mt. Baker trip.

There may be an avalanche involved, but somehow everything ends up super funny.



In the second jam video, Jack busts out a impromptu song about his Beer and Cheerios. We don't want to give away to much, but it's "Amazing."
